Lily Hospitals Limited, established since 1986 remains one of the foremost hospitals in Nigeria and within the South-South region of the country.

It is the first private hospital in Nigeria to achieve ISO 9001:2000 quality management system certification from the Standards Organization of Nigeria (SON) and was also recently accredited with COHSASA (Council for Health Service Accreditation of Southern Africa) Certificate.
